What is the prefix in the word thermometer?

thermometer (n.) 1630s, from French thermomètre (1620s), coined by Jesuit Father Jean Leuréchon from Greek thermos “hot” (see thermal) + metron “measure” (from PIE root *me- (2) “to measure”). An earlier, Latinate form was thermoscopium (1610s).

Why is was alcohol used in thermometers?

Unlike the mercury-in-glass thermometer, the contents of an alcohol thermometer are less toxic and will evaporate quickly. The ethanol version is the most widely used due to the low cost and relatively low hazard posed by the liquid in case of breakage.

What is prefix or suffix of heat?

We use a thermometer to measure how hot or cold something is. The prefix therm means heat and the suffix meter means to measure and so together the word means ‘to measure heat’.

Is a mercury thermometer better than the alcohol based thermometer?

It is more durable than alcohol thermometer because mercury does not evaporate easily. It is smaller in size as compared to alcohol one. Mercury does not wet the wall of the thermometer, which means that results can be highly accurate.
